A double glazed window is a window with two glass panes that are sealed hermetically. Each pane of glass is separated by a spacer, and the space between them is filled with inert gases (usually argon, Krypton). These gases act as insulation, keeping the heat inside your home. Double-glazed windows are more energy efficient than single-pane windows. The frame material, the dimensions and the type of glazing are all aspects that can influence the energy efficiency. uPVC frames, for example are more energy efficient than timber and aluminium. The argon gas or krypton that fills the gap between the glass panes also helps to reduce the energy cost. It is crucial to check the accreditations of the firm that will provide your double-glazed window. Ideally, look for those that are accredited by FENSA, which is the government-authorised scheme that monitors compliance with building regulations for replacement windows and doors. Security Double glazing can improve your home's security by making it more difficult for burglars to gain entry into your property. This is because single glass panes as well as aluminium or timber windows can be smashed quite easily by opportunistic or professional thieves. Double glazing uses two glass panes and locking mechanisms that are significantly more resistant to breaking. This makes it more difficult for burglars to enter your home or business. They are also prevented from damaging valuable objects and taking them. Double glazed windows are made from two glass panes with a space between them, which is sealed together inside a unit called an IGU (insulated glazing unit). The glass is laminated or tempered to provide durability and the gap is filled with air or, more often, argon gas. It is a non-toxic and inert gas with no odour and has excellent insulation properties. There are a variety of glass options to choose from that include tints and UV blockers, as well as low-e film that are very energy-efficient. Upgrade to toughened safety glasses that are up to five times stronger than normal glass. This reduces the risk of injury, particularly in young children. Double-glazed windows are constructed of two glass panes which are separated by an insulating space filled with air or an inert gas such as argon. They provide better insulation to single-pane windows, and you can choose from various options such as coatings and frames. Certain manufacturers also offer acoustic windows that can block out the sound from outside. The material used to create the frame and glass determines the thermal performance of double-glazed windows. uPVC, which is cheap and is extremely insulating, is the most popular material for double glazing. It is also eco-friendly and can be recycled multiple times without losing its function. Upvc frames come in a variety of colors and finishes. This makes it easy to fit your home's style.
